Android学习总结——实现Home键功能
2016-10-12 21:20
375 查看
实现Home键功能简而言之就是回到桌面,让Activity不销毁,程序后台运行。
实现方法:
这里我将重写返回键让其实现home键的功能:
需要重写onKeyDown方法监控返回键
实现方法:
Intent intent= new Intent(Intent.ACTION_MAIN); int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K); intent.addCategory(Intent.CATEGORY_HOME); startActivity(intent);
这里我将重写返回键让其实现home键的功能:
需要重写onKeyDown方法监控返回键
public boolean onKeyDown(int keyCode, KeyEvent event) {
//如果是返回键
if(keyCode== KeyEvent.KEYCODE_BACK&&event.getRepeatCount() == 0){
//重写返回键
Intent intent= new Intent(Intent.ACTION_MAIN); intent.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K); intent.addCategory(Intent.CATEGORY_HOME); startActivity(intent);
return true;
}
return super.onKeyDown(keyCode, event);
}
相关文章推荐
- Android service学习总结和利用service实现的后台音乐播放功能
- Android学习总结(八)———— 广播的最佳实践(实现强制下线功能)
- Android功能总结:仿照Launcher的Workspace实现左右滑动切换
- Android功能总结:仿照Launcher的Workspace实现左右滑动切换
- android实现换肤功能的方法总结
- android学习总结(五)---简单浏览器demo的实现
- android的手机任务管理器,关键功能实现方法总结
- Android多媒体学习十一:实现仿百度图片查看功能
- android APP 中微信分享功能实现 的总结
- Android之UI学习篇七:ImageView实现适屏和裁剪图片的功能
- Android学习:播放功能的实现
- Android多媒体学习十一:实现仿百度图片查看功能
- Android开发学习笔记:Button事件实现方法的总结
- Android功能总结:仿照Launcher的Workspace实现左右滑动切换
- android APP 中微信分享功能实现 的总结
- android 学习笔记3--静默安装功能的实现
- android的手机任务管理器,关键功能实现方法总结
- Android功能总结:仿照Launcher的Workspace实现左右滑动切换
- android的手机任务管理器,关键功能实现方法总结
- android APP 中微信分享功能实现 的总结